Project Types

Common Water Damage Remediation Jobs

Flood damage cleanup involves removing excess water and drying affected areas to prevent further harm.

Leaking pipe repairs address plumbing issues that cause water intrusion and damage inside the property.

Sewage backup remediation involves safely removing contaminated water and sanitizing affected spaces.

Roof leak repairs prevent water from entering the building and causing interior water damage.

Basement water extraction removes standing water to reduce mold growth and structural damage risks.

Storm damage restoration restores property after heavy rain or flooding incidents, focusing on water removal and drying.

FAQ

Water Damage Remediation Questions

What causes water damage in homes? Water damage can result from leaks, burst pipes, flooding, or appliance failures that allow water to seep into building materials.

How can water damage affect a property? It can lead to structural issues, mold growth, and damage to furniture and personal belongings if not addressed promptly.

What are common signs of water damage? Visible stains, musty odors, warped flooring, or peeling paint can indicate water intrusion in a property.

What is the first step in water damage remediation? Identifying and stopping the source of water is essential before beginning cleanup and repair efforts.
